Senses
уста́ть is used for these senses in English:
- fatigue (intransitive) To lose so much strength or energy that one becomes tired, weary, feeble or exhausted.
- stuffed (UK, Ireland, Australia, New Zealand, informal) Very tired.
- tire (intransitive) To become sleepy or weary.
- zonk (intransitive, slang, usually followed by “out”) To become exhausted, sleepy or delirious.
